#include "IResearchPrimaryKeyFilter.h"
#include "index/index_reader.hpp"
#include "utils/hash_utils.hpp"
namespace arangodb {
namespace iresearch {
// ----------------------------------------------------------------------------
// --SECTION-- PrimaryKeyFilter implementation
// ----------------------------------------------------------------------------
irs::doc_iterator::ptr PrimaryKeyFilter::execute(
irs::sub_reader const& segment,
irs::order::prepared const& /*order*/,
irs::attribute_view const& /*ctx*/
) const {
if (&segment != _pkIterator._pkSegment) {
return irs::doc_iterator::empty();
}
// aliasing constructor
return irs::doc_iterator::ptr(
irs::doc_iterator::ptr(),
const_cast<PrimaryKeyIterator*>(&_pkIterator)
);
}
size_t PrimaryKeyFilter::hash() const noexcept {
size_t seed = 0;
irs::hash_combine(seed, filter::hash());
irs::hash_combine(seed, _pk.cid());
irs::hash_combine(seed, _pk.rid());
return seed;
}
irs::filter::prepared::ptr PrimaryKeyFilter::prepare(
irs::index_reader const& index,
irs::order::prepared const& /*ord*/,
irs::boost::boost_t /*boost*/,
irs::attribute_view const& /*ctx*/
) const {
auto const pkRef = static_cast<irs::bytes_ref>(_pk);
for (auto& segment : index) {
auto* pkField = segment.field(arangodb::iresearch::DocumentPrimaryKey::PK());
if (!pkField) {
continue;
}
auto term = pkField->iterator();
if (!term->seek(pkRef)) {
continue;
}
auto docs = term->postings(irs::flags::empty_instance());
if (docs->next()) {
_pkIterator.reset(segment, docs->value());
}
break;
}
// aliasing constructor
return irs::filter::prepared::ptr(irs::filter::prepared::ptr(), this);
}
bool PrimaryKeyFilter::equals(filter const& rhs) const noexcept {
auto const& trhs = static_cast<PrimaryKeyFilter const&>(rhs);
return filter::equals(rhs)
&& _pk.cid() == trhs._pk.cid()
&& _pk.rid() == trhs._pk.rid();
}
DEFINE_FILTER_TYPE(PrimaryKeyFilter);
} // iresearch
} // arangodb
